PHOTO: Wild's Bryzgalov poses for selfies with fans during preseason game
Adam Hunger / USA TODAY Sports
In case we needed more evidence that the NHL needs a character like Ilya Bryzgalov, the would-be Minnesota Wild goaltender devoted time during Monday's preseason game against the Pittsburgh Penguins to posing for photos with fans.
